You can instantly start messaging them in a safe and personal chat space once you’ve been matched with a therapist.
The chat room is accessible at any time as long as your gadget has dependable web. Messaging isn’t carried out in real-time, so there’s no guaranteed reaction time from your therapist. As a result, you’re complimentary to message your counselor at any hour of the day.
Your counselor will reply with concerns, homework, feedback, or guidance, and the app will inform you of their response.
The discussions are conserved in the chatroom so you’re free to go over and reflect whenever you ‘d like. Every discussion is also safeguarded by stringent federal and state HIPAA laws.

Live phone session
For those who choose resolving problems aloud, it’s possible to arrange an hour-long call with your therapist.
The system doesn’t share your personal telephone number with the therapist and whatever is done through the app.
Live video session
If you’re somebody who delights in in person conversation, you can also set up a video session with your counselor. Just go to at your visit time and your therapist will trigger you to start the video chat.

How does it work?
As seen on FB (by me, anyway), United States company is the business behemoth of the e-counselling video game. They claim to have 500 licensed counsellors working for them, each with at least three years of experience.
After completing a questionnaire to establish what particular flavour of mental you are, you’re paired with a counsellor, who you can mercilessly swap for a different one at any time. (I got Dr. Laura Dabney, from Virginia). You then start an immediate messaged therapy session that both you and your counsellor can drop in and out of, and which could, in theory, continue up until among you ultimately passed away.
What does it cost?
You get a complimentary seven-day trial – much like a complimentary Netflix or Amazon Prime trial, other than with method more concerns about what your childhood was like. After that, it costs from , 24.50 a week for endless message-based counselling and one ‘totally free’ phone session with your counsellor per month. Yeah, I do not get how it’s free either, but whatever.
